masculine · English origin
Al is an English short form of any of several names beginning with the element Al-, most commonly Albert, Alfred, or Alan. Albert derives from the Old High German elements adal, meaning noble, and beraht, meaning bright, while Alfred comes from Old English aelf, meaning elf, and raed, meaning counsel. The name has been borne by numerous well-known figures, including jazz musician Al Jolson and boxer Muhammad Ali, who was commonly called Al in early life. Related forms include Alf, Albie, and the fuller names Albert, Alfred, and Alan.
